Warnock will also probably go too. If we sell at a loss, which we'd have to with Blackman, Johnson, Camara and Weimann, the amortisation payments have to be taken from the figure that we get in. There is a good chance that we'd actually end up with a book profit (which is what FFP uses) something close to zero, maybe even a small loss. Sadly, if we want to generate profit it will have to cone from Hughes, Martin or Hendrick.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
